What Is the Knowledge Scaling Problem in Professional Services?

Professional services firms have a structurally difficult scaling problem. Revenue growth requires adding more senior professionals, but senior professionals are expensive, scarce, and take years to develop. A consultancy growing 20% annually must recruit, train, and retain 20% more senior consultants each year — a challenge that becomes increasingly difficult as the talent pool is finite and competition for experienced professionals intensifies across Asia-Pacific. The average fully-loaded cost of a senior management consultant in the region exceeds $350,000 annually, and utilization targets of 70-80% leave limited capacity for knowledge development and internal initiatives.

AI addresses this scaling problem by augmenting senior professionals rather than replacing them. An AI agent that has access to the firm's entire knowledge base — past proposals, engagement reports, methodology documents, industry research, and client correspondence — can provide junior consultants with the contextual knowledge that previously only came from senior expertise. When a junior consultant working on a manufacturing client's digital transformation can ask 'What approach did we use for the last three manufacturing digital transformation engagements, and what were the key lessons learned?' and receive a comprehensive, sourced answer in seconds, the effective expertise available to the client multiplies without adding senior headcount.

The technology enabling this knowledge scaling has three layers. MCP connectors integrate with the firm's knowledge management systems — document management platforms, CRM systems, and project management tools — providing AI agents with access to the full knowledge base. A knowledge graph encodes the relationships between engagements, methodologies, industries, and outcomes, enabling the AI to reason about which past experiences are relevant to the current situation. The conversational interface delivers this knowledge through natural language queries in the IM platforms that consultants already use daily.

How Does AI-Powered Proposal Development Work?

Proposal development is one of the highest-value applications of AI in professional services. Firms typically invest 5-8% of senior consultant time in proposal development — researching the prospect's industry, drafting approach documents, and tailoring past case studies to the prospect's specific situation. For a 500-person consultancy, this represents 25-40 full-time equivalent consultants dedicated to proposals rather than billable client work.

AI agents transform proposal development by automating the research and drafting phases while preserving the strategic thinking that differentiates winning proposals. An AI agent can research a prospect's industry, competitive position, and strategic challenges in minutes using MCP connectors to external data sources and the firm's internal knowledge base. It can then draft initial proposal sections — problem statement, proposed approach, team qualifications, relevant case studies — that senior consultants refine and personalise. This approach reduces proposal development time by 45-60% while maintaining or improving quality.

The impact on win rates is significant. Firms deploying AI-powered proposal development report 35% improvement in proposal win rates. The improvement comes from two factors. First, AI enables the firm to pursue more proposals with the same team because each proposal requires less time — increasing the number of opportunities in the pipeline. Second, AI-generated proposals are better researched and more consistently tailored to the prospect's specific situation, because the AI has access to more relevant information than any individual consultant could assemble manually. How Does AI Enhance Client Engagement and Delivery?

Beyond proposals, AI agents enhance every phase of the client engagement lifecycle. During scoping, AI agents can help consultants quickly assess client data, identify patterns, and develop hypotheses before the first client meeting — making the initial engagement more productive and demonstrating expertise from day one. During delivery, AI agents provide real-time access to methodology guidance, best practices, and relevant precedents, reducing the time consultants spend searching for reference materials and increasing the time spent on client-facing analysis and recommendation development.

The most advanced firms are deploying AI agents that act as engagement assistants — persistent AI collaborators that maintain context across the entire engagement. The engagement assistant knows the project scope, the client's industry, the methodology being applied, and the deliverables expected. As the engagement progresses, the assistant learns from the team's interactions, building an engagement-specific knowledge base that improves its usefulness over time. When a new team member joins the engagement, the assistant provides a comprehensive orientation based on all prior work — reducing the ramp-up time from weeks to days.

The financial impact of AI-powered engagement delivery is substantial. Firms report 25% increase in billable hours as consultants spend less time on internal research and administration. Client satisfaction scores improve by 15-20% because engagements are delivered faster, with more consistent quality, and with fewer knowledge gaps. Perhaps most importantly, the firm's knowledge base grows automatically with each engagement — AI agents capture and structure insights from every project, creating a self-improving knowledge system that makes future engagements more efficient and effective.

What Is the Implementation Roadmap for Professional Services?

Professional services firms should implement AI in three phases. Phase one focuses on knowledge management — building MCP connectors to the firm's document management systems, CRM, and project management tools, and deploying a conversational interface that allows consultants to query the knowledge base in natural language. This phase typically delivers immediate value by reducing the time consultants spend searching for information by 40-50%. Phase two adds proposal development capabilities — AI agents that can research prospects, draft proposal sections, and identify relevant case studies. Phase three deploys engagement assistants that provide persistent, context-aware AI support throughout the client engagement lifecycle.

The cultural challenge is as important as the technical one. Professional services firms must address consultant concerns about AI replacing their expertise. The most successful firms position AI as an expertise multiplier, not a replacement — AI handles the information gathering and synthesis that consumes valuable time, freeing consultants to focus on the relationship management, creative problem-solving, and strategic advice that clients value most and that AI cannot replicate. Firms that invest in this positioning alongside technical implementation report 3x higher consultant adoption rates and faster ROI realisation.

Where Do AI Gains Actually Show Up in Professional Services?

The gains concentrate in two places: non-billable overhead and the speed of turning analysis into client-ready output. Time spent chasing data, formatting reports, and reconciling versions is time that cannot be billed, so any reduction there flows straight to margin. Firms that automate report assembly and data pull commonly report reclaiming several hours per engagement per week, which compounds across a portfolio of projects.

The second-order benefit is consistency. When a model enforces the firm's methodology and formatting, the output quality stops depending on which associate produced the draft. That standardisation matters for compliance and for the brand, and it is often the difference between a firm that scales by hiring and one that scales by leverage.

How Do You Govern Client Confidentiality When Using AI?

In professional services, the product is judgment built on client confidentiality, so AI adoption lives or dies on how client data is handled. The non-negotiable rules: no client content in public or general-purpose models, strict tenant isolation so one client's data can never inform another's response, and approved-tool-only policies backed by data-processing agreements. Redact or tokenise direct identifiers before anything leaves the firm's boundary, enforce retention limits so drafts and prompts are purged on schedule, and require human review of any client-facing output, because an AI-generated proposal error is still the firm's error.

Operationalise this with an approved-tool register and a classification step at intake: a matter's data is tagged confidential at the door, and only tools cleared for that classification may touch it. The governance payoff is speed — when confidentiality is enforced by the platform rather than by individual caution, professionals use AI freely instead of avoiding it. Firms that got this right in 2025 reported higher adoption precisely because people trusted the guardrails, not in spite of them.

What Operating Model Makes AI Stick in Professional Services Firms?

Technology alone does not change a partnership culture; the operating model does. Stand up a centre of excellence that sets standards and an approved-tool register, but embed AI champions inside each practice so adoption is local and credible rather than mandated from the centre. Align incentives with the firm's economics — if leverage and realisation drive profit, measure and reward time saved on drafting and research, and reinvest it in higher-value client work rather than billing the same hours for less effort.

Make the firm's own knowledge a managed asset: codify playbooks, precedents, and proposals so the AI draws on the firm's accumulated expertise, not the open internet. Partner accountability matters most — when partners ask "how did AI help this engagement," the behaviour spreads. The firms pulling ahead treat AI not as a tool rolled out but as a capability the operating model is rebuilt around, with governance, incentives, and knowledge assets all pointing the same way.

What Does AI Leverage Look Like on a Firm's Profit and Loss Statement?

Professional services economics reduce to three ratios: utilisation, realisation, and leverage. Utilisation is the share of paid hours that are billable; realisation is the share of standard rates actually collected; leverage is the ratio of junior to senior hours on an engagement. AI moves all three, but it moves them by different mechanisms and at different speeds, and confusing the three is why some firms invest heavily and see nothing on the bottom line.

Utilisation improves first and most visibly, because it is a subtraction problem: every hour a consultant stops searching for a precedent, reformatting a deck, or reconciling two spreadsheets is an hour that can be billed. Realisation improves more slowly, and only if the firm changes how it prices — an engagement that used to take 400 hours and now takes 260 will still be billed at the old fee unless the commercial model is revisited. Leverage improves last, and it is the most valuable: when juniors can produce work that previously required a senior reviewer, the firm can take on more engagements without adding partners, which is the only structurally scalable path to margin growth.

MetricTypical pre-AI baselineMechanism of improvementRealistic 12-month gain
Utilisation70-80%Research, drafting, and formatting hours removed from delivery3-6 percentage points
Realisation85-92%Better-scoped proposals and fewer write-offs from rework1-3 percentage points
Leverage3:1 to 5:1 junior to seniorJuniors producing partner-review-ready first drafts0.5-1.0x improvement
Proposal cycle time3-6 weeksAutomated research and first-draft generation45-60% reduction
Revenue per partnerBaselineCombination of the four effects above8-15% uplift

The trap in this table is the last row. Revenue per partner only rises if the freed capacity is sold, not absorbed. Firms that treat AI as a cost-reduction programme end up with idle capacity and quickly lose the people who produced the savings; firms that treat it as a capacity-creation programme redeploy the hours into more proposals, more engagements, and deeper client relationships. The difference is a management decision made in month one, not a technology outcome.

How Should Firms Price AI-Augmented Engagements?

When delivery takes 30% fewer hours, hourly billing quietly transfers the entire productivity gain to the client. Most firms discover this about two quarters after deployment, when utilisation is up but revenue is flat. Four pricing responses are in use, and the right answer is usually a blend rather than a single model.

Fixed-fee and milestone pricing converts efficiency into margin immediately and is the simplest place to start, but it requires honest scoping discipline or the firm absorbs the risk of scope creep. Value-based pricing ties the fee to a client outcome — a cost reduction, a successful system cutover, a regulatory clearance — and captures the most upside, but it demands the confidence to quantify value up front and the data to defend it afterwards. Subscription or retainer pricing works well for ongoing advisory work where the deliverable is access to judgement rather than a document, and it smooths the revenue volatility that makes professional services hard to value. Hybrid models — a fixed platform fee plus outcome-linked success components — are increasingly the default for AI-heavy engagements because they let the client see the efficiency gain while letting the firm keep some of it.

Whichever model a firm chooses, two mechanics matter more than the headline structure. First, instrument delivery from day one so you can prove the hours saved; without that evidence, every pricing conversation is an argument about anecdotes. Second, publish an internal policy on AI disclosure. Clients increasingly ask directly whether AI was used and how outputs were verified, and firms that answer confidently — with a documented review process, named reviewers, and a stated confidentiality posture — convert that question into a trust advantage rather than a defence.

What Does a 12-Month Adoption Roadmap Look Like?

The firms that succeed sequence adoption around knowledge assets rather than around tools. Knowledge has to be findable before it can be reasoned over, and it has to be governed before it can be exposed to a model. That sequencing produces a four-quarter plan in which each quarter delivers something the firm can sell, not just something it can demo.

QuarterFocusDeliverableSuccess signal
Q1Knowledge inventory and governanceClassified corpus of proposals, engagement reports, and methodologies with named ownersAnswerable questions with citations
Q2Proposal and research augmentationAI-drafted research packs and first-draft proposal sectionsProposal cycle time down 30%+
Q3Delivery augmentationMethodology guidance and precedent retrieval inside delivery teamsMeasurable reduction in rework hours
Q4Commercial model changeRevised pricing templates and AI disclosure policyRealisation and revenue per partner improving

Two organisational choices determine whether the roadmap completes. Assign a partner-level owner with a commercial target, not just a technology sponsor — adoption stalls when it is owned by IT and measured in logins. And start with one practice area rather than the whole firm: a single vertical with a motivated managing partner produces a reference case in one quarter, and a reference case does more for firm-wide adoption than any amount of centrally mandated training.
